**Vendor note: Inkmill markdown pipeline**

Rendering for Parchway docs is outsourced to Inkmill under an annual contract, renewing each March. They handle sanitization and PDF export; we own the upload queue. SLA: 4-hour response on rendering failures. Escalate only after two failed retries. Their support desk is reachable at the address below.

billing contact of hahaf-baguf = zorael.tammir.jorius@sivrelhq.internal

**Ticket: Signature check failing on contrast-audit bundle**

Heads up for the sync: the automated color-contrast audit package for Lumenhue keeps failing verification in CI. Marisol re-ran the audit on the dashboard palette (all AA checks pass, btw), but the artifact won't deploy because the signature doesn't match. Looks like the pipeline is still pinned to the old key from the Q2 rotation. To unblock, re-sign the bundle with the current key, shown below.

deploy key for kajof-fajop: bky6_gDHw9Q

# Fernhollow Telemetry Gateway — Environments

Three environments: dev, staging, prod. Dev runs on the Oakhurst cluster; staging and prod run in the Calloway region. Field units (tractors, seeders) only ever talk to prod. Staging receives replayed traffic nightly. Do not point hardware at dev — it lacks rate limiting and will accept malformed frames silently. Deploys go through the Fernhollow pipeline, staging first, prod after a 24-hour soak. Credentials come from the vault team. The staging environment's configuration values are as follows.

config for faduf-fahip:
ELIAX_LOG_LEVEL=error
ELIAX_METRICS_HOST=metrics.eliax.zemvarcorp.corp
ELIAX_POOL_SIZE=16